How To Reduce Pain Around Tragus After Piercing?

I got my tragus pierced more than a month ago now and its healing very well other than abit of pain on the surrounds when you touch it, it looks perfectly normal no swelling redness etc but its just a little painfull only when i touch it i also clean it daily any tips on how to get rid of the pain and is it normal and what may be causing it?

As per your complain a pierced tragus can take a longer time to heal as there is inflammation caused due to piercing the soft tissues tend to heal slowly..
If there is no other symptoms like swelling, redness or formation of a bump you need not to worry and just keep the area clean but do not apply excessive pressure or don't do harsh rubbing over the pierced site to avoid further trauma..
You can apply a Steroid based ointment like Hydrocortisone ointment as it can help in healing fast..
Do cold compresses..
Apply turmeric mixed with musturd oil over the site as it has antiseptic properties..
